Will Smith

Will Smith

Men in Black and Fresh Prince of Bel-Air actor Will Smith sparked the flames for the wildfire dad-bod trend across social media with a May 2, 2021, post proudly showing off his paunch and candidly admitting, "I’m gonna be real wit yall - I’m in the worst shape of my life." His over-arching influence across social media platforms quickly made stars and fans alike flood the #bigwilliechallenge hashtag with workout pics. From posting videos of his private training sessions to highlighting fans who are proudly taking up the challenge, Smith puts his Instagram influence to good use.

 

This trend isn't just about inspiring others to take the plunge and join a gym, but feeling good in the body you already have as well! In a follow-up pic posted to Instagram, he took a boomerang of his dad bod and doubled-down on the message of body positivity: "This is the body that carried me through an entire pandemic and countless days grazing thru the pantry. I love this body, but I wanna FEEL better. No more midnight muffins…this is it! Imma get in the BEST SHAPE OF MY LIFE!!!!!"

Christian Bale

Christian Bale

Christian Bale is one of the most versatile actors in the industry, evidenced by how he undergoes unbelievable transformations for each role. These stark differences between characters aren't chalked up to the makeup chair alone; Bale has ballooned up in weight and drastically whittled down to the bone in order to capture the director's vision. From dropping to 120 pounds for The Machinist to gaining 100 pounds for American Hustle, Bale knows a thing or two about commitment. 

His role as Dick Cheney in Vice was the last straw for the actor, however. He really rocked the dad bod for his role as the 46th Vice President, but he's not so crazy about method acting anymore. Telling CBS This Morning in 2019, Bale said, "I keep saying I’m done with it. I really think I’m done with it, yeah.”

Chris Pratt

Chris Pratt

Let’s take a moment to reminisce about Chris Pratt’s portrayal as Andy Dwyer in Parks and Recreation. Half of his role hinged on rocking his lovable dad bod for seven seasons, and everyone was on board. Then came Jurassic World and Guardians of the Galaxy, and Pratt suddenly had to drop the weight in exchange for rock-hard abs that were appropriate for training dinosaurs and battling aliens.

Pratt admitted that getting in shape was “a nightmare,” according to Men’s Journal, and dropped 60 pounds in six months. Keeping up the shredded physique isn’t easy, and he’s since been spotted letting his OG dad bod peek through between film shoots.
